Based on a specimen preserved in the snakebite treatment center in eastern Nepal, this study aims to analyse brief life history (i.e., litter size, parturition date, habitat preference) of Enhydris enhydris, effects of its envenoming, and anthropogenic threat on its populations. One euthanized gravid female E. enhydris collected alive from eastern Nepal by a snakebite victim was examined. The gravid female gave birth to 23 litters on July 11, 2012. This parturition suggested high reproductive potential. Its bite to a man walking on the road caused no ill-effects. However, the use of tourniquet as a part of prehospital care might be detrimental or be obstacle for in-hospital care of snakebite. The conflicts between E. enhydris and humans at roads and human-activity areas are inevitable across the distribution ranges of this species. The continued anthropogenic impact can threaten its populations. This study finding can be a basis for assessing conservation status and options for its conservation as well as prehospital care and prevention of its bites.

It is vital to keep an eye on changes in climatic extremes because they set the stage for current and potential future climate, which usually have a reasonable adverse impact on ecosystems and society. The present study examines the variability and trends in precipitation and temperature across seasons in the Kinnaur district, offering valuable insights into the complex dynamics of the Himalayan climate. Using Climatic Research Unit gridded Time Series (CRU TS) datasets from 1951 to 2021, the study analyzes the data to produce 28 climate indices based on India Meteorological Department (IMD) convention indices and Expert Team on Climate Change Detection and Indices (ETCCDI). Although there may be considerable variation in climate indices in terms of absolute values within different products, there is consensus in both long-term trends and inter-annual variability. Analysis shows that even within a small area, there is variability in the magnitude and direction of historic temperature trends. Initially, the data were subjected to rigorous quality control procedures, which involved identifying anomalies. Statistical analysis like trend analysis, employing Mann-Kendall test and Sen's slope estimator, reveal significant (p < 0.05) increase in consecutive dry days (CDD) at 0.03 days/year and decrease in consecutive wet days (CWD) at 0.02 days/year. Notably, the frequency of heavy precipitation occurrences showed an increasing trend. Changes in precipitation in the Western Himalaya are driven by a complex interplay of orographic effects, monsoonal dynamics, atmospheric circulation patterns, climate change, and localized factors such as topography, atmospheric circulation patterns, moisture sources, land-sea temperature contrasts, and anthropogenic influences. Moreover, in case of temperature indices, there is significant increasing trend observed. Temperature indices indicate a significant annual increase in warm nights (TN90p) at 0.06%/year and warm days (TX90p) at 0.11%/year. Extreme temperature events have been trending upward, with monthly daily maximum temperature (TXx) increasing by 1.5 °C yearly. This study enhances our comprehension of the global warming phenomenon and underscores the importance of acknowledging alterations in the water cycle and their repercussions on hydrologic resources, agriculture, and livelihoods in the cold desert of the northwestern Indian Himalaya.

This study investigated the effect of adding lignin nanoparticles (LNPs) derived from Oxytenanthera abyssinica via alkali-acid nanoprecipitation method to polyvinyl alcohol/chitosan (PVA/CI) and polyvinyl alcohol/chitin (PVA/CH) films for the active food packaging applications. Adding LNPs at concentrations of 1 % and 3 % improved the films' thermal stability and mechanical properties. The lowest water solubility and moisture content were observed in PVA/CI/LNPs films. LNPs exhibited effective 2,2-diphenyl-1-picrylhydrazyl (DPPH) radical scavenging activities, with the highest values observed in PVA/CH/LNPS and PVA/CI/LNPS films with values of 87.47 and 88.74 % respectively. The addition of LNPs also improved the UV-blocking abilities of the films. PVA/CH/LNP3 and PVA/CI/LNP3 have the smallest percentage transmission values of 3.34 % and 0.86 % in the UV range. The overall migration of dietary stimulants was lower in PVA/CI/LNPS and PVA/CH/LNPS films compared to PVA film. Antibacterial tests demonstrated the inhibitory capacity of the synthesized biofilms against both gram-positive and negative bacterial species, with the highest inhibitory value of 26 mm. The study suggests that PVA/CH/LNPS and PVA/CI/LNPS films have potential applications as active food packaging materials and can be explored in other potential applications such as drug delivery, tissue engineering, wound healing, and slow-release urea fertilizer development.

Cardiovascular diseases (CVDs) are the world's leading killers, accounting for 30% deaths. According to the WHO report, CVDs kill 17.9 million people per year, and there will be 22.2 million deaths from CVD in 2030. The death rates rise as people get older. Regarding gender, the death rate of women by CVD (51%) is higher than that of men (42%). To decrease and prevent CVD, most people rely on traditional medicine originating from the plant (phytochemicals) in addition to or in preference to commercially available drugs to recover from their illness. The CVD therapy efficacy of 92 plants, including 15 terrestrial plants, is examined. Some medicinal plants well known to treat CVD are, Daucus carota, Nerium oleander, Amaranthus Viridis, Ginkgo biloba, Terminalia arjuna, Picrorhiza kurroa, Salvia miltiorrhiza, Tinospora cordifolia, Mucuna pruriens, Hydrocotyle asiatica, Bombax ceiba, and Andrographis paniculate. The active phytochemicals found in these plants are flavonoids, polyphenols, plant sterol, plant sulphur compounds, and terpenoids. A general flavonoid mechanism of action is to prevent low-density lipoprotein oxidation, which promotes vasodilatation. Plant sterols prevent CVD by decreasing cholesterol absorption in the blood. Plant sulphur compound also prevent CVD by activation of nuclear factor-erythroid factor 2-related factor 2 (Nrf2) and inhibition of cholesterol synthesis. Quinone decreases the risk of CVD by increasing ATP production in mitochondria while terpenoids by decreasing atherosclerotic lesion in the aortic valve. Although several physiologically active compounds with recognized biological effects have been found in various plants because of the increased prevalence of CVD, appropriate CVD prevention and treatment measures are required. More research is needed to understand the mechanism and specific plants' phytochemicals responsible for treating CVD.

Background Momordica charantia is evoloving as supplementary therapy in type 2 diabetes mellitus. Animal studies reveal its anti-diabetic and lipid lowering property. However, clinical studies with human subjects are very few. Objective To find out the effects of Momordica charantia supplements on glycemic and lipid profile among type 2 diabetes mellitus patients taking allopathic drugs. Method A comparative study was conducted in internal medicine department of B P Koirala Institute of Health Sciences, Dharan from July 2015 to May 2016 after ethical clearance. Twenty two uncomplicated type-2 diabetes mellitus patients were enrolled. Group A patients were supplemented with allopathic drug (oral anti-diabetic agents) only and Group B with add on treatment of 200 ml juice of Momordica charantia along with allopathic drug daily for ninety days. Fasting, post prandial blood sugar and lipid profile levels were compared between baseline and ninety days post supplementation. Data was collected and entry was done in Statistical Packages for Social Services version 20.0, using independent t test with p < 0.05. Result Add on treatment with 200 ml of Momordica charantia along with anti-diabetic drug daily significantly reduced fasting (p= < 0.0001) and post prandial blood sugar (p < 0.0001). Treatment with anti-diabetic drugs only reduced fasting (p = 0.0008) and post-prandial blood sugar but the reduction was not significant ((p =0.0001). There was improvement in lipid profile by both anti-diabetic drugs alone and Momordica charantia along with anti-diabetic drug, but it was not significant. Conclusion Add on treatment with 200 ml/day juice of Momordica charantia is effective in glycaemic control in type-2 diabetes mellitus patients as compared to the allopathic treatment alone.

Guidelines for doctors managing osteoporosis in the Asia-Pacific region vary widely. We compared 18 guidelines for similarities and differences in five key areas. We then used a structured consensus process to develop clinical standards of care for the diagnosis and management of osteoporosis and for improving the quality of care. PURPOSE: Minimum clinical standards for assessment and management of osteoporosis are needed in the Asia-Pacific (AP) region to inform clinical practice guidelines (CPGs) and to improve osteoporosis care. We present the framework of these clinical standards and describe its development. METHODS: We conducted a structured comparative analysis of existing CPGs in the AP region using a "5IQ" model (identification, investigation, information, intervention, integration, and quality). One-hundred data elements were extracted from each guideline. We then employed a four-round Delphi consensus process to structure the framework, identify key components of guidance, and develop clinical care standards. RESULTS: Eighteen guidelines were included. The 5IQ analysis demonstrated marked heterogeneity, notably in guidance on risk factors, the use of biochemical markers, self-care information for patients, indications for osteoporosis treatment, use of fracture risk assessment tools, and protocols for monitoring treatment. There was minimal guidance on long-term management plans or on strategies and systems for clinical quality improvement. Twenty-nine APCO members participated in the Delphi process, resulting in consensus on 16 clinical standards, with levels of attainment defined for those on identification and investigation of fragility fractures, vertebral fracture assessment, and inclusion of quality metrics in guidelines. CONCLUSION: The 5IQ analysis confirmed previous anecdotal observations of marked heterogeneity of osteoporosis clinical guidelines in the AP region. The Framework provides practical, clear, and feasible recommendations for osteoporosis care and can be adapted for use in other such vastly diverse regions. Implementation of the standards is expected to significantly lessen the global burden of osteoporosis.

AIM: Pelvic exenteration is the only surgical option for locally advanced pelvic malignancies infiltrating the surrounding organs. The resultant pelvic void after the procedure is responsible for a number of complications, collectively termed empty pelvis syndrome (EPS). We aim to show how EPS can be minimized by presenting a case series demonstrating the surgical technique of laparoscopic total pelvic exenteration with bilateral pelvic node dissection along with a novel use of the Bakri balloon. METHOD: This is a case series of three successive patients undergoing laparoscopic total pelvic exenteration for locally advanced primary, nonmetastatic rectal adenocarcinoma over a period of 1 month in a specialized colorectal unit at a tertiary cancer centre. The Bakri balloon was deployed in all three patients and retained for variable time intervals postoperatively. Features of EPS were prospectively documented. RESULTS: In the first patient, the Bakri balloon was completely deflated and removed on postoperative day (POD) 5. The patient developed subacute intestinal obstruction which resolved with conservative management by POD 12. In the second and third patients, the Bakri balloon was deflated in a sequential manner, beginning on POD 8, until it was finally removed on POD 11. Neither of these patients had any abdominal complaints. A postoperative CT scan of both these patients showed the small bowel loops clearly above the pelvic inlet. CONCLUSIONS: The Bakri balloon is a simple, safe and cost-effective method to reduce the complications of EPS following laparoscopic total pelvic exenteration. A prospective study is ongoing to objectively quantify the benefits of this technique.

Background Acne vulgaris has considerable impact on physical and psychological health. Isotretinoin is considered most effective drug available for acne therapy but with limited acceptance because of its adverse effects. Antihistamine inhibits inflammatory mediators, Propionibacterium acne induced itching, reduction of squalene and sebum in sebocyte, reduces anxiety and further lessens hormonal derangement and inhibits mast cell induced fibrosis and scars. Clinical relevance is lacking in the use of antihistamine in the treatment of acne and its potential efficacy needs to be clarified. Objective To evaluate the efficacy and safety of combining isotretinoin and antihistamine compare to isotretinoin alone in patients with moderate to severe acne at week 12. Method One hundred patients with moderate to severe acne were included in this randomised, controlled comparative study. Fifty patients were treated with isotretinoin and 50 patients were treated with additional antihistamine, levocetirizine and assessment was done at baseline, 4, 8 and 12 weeks of treatment. Result At week 12, compared to isotretinoin only group, combination of isotretinoin and levocetirizine group showed more statistically significant decrease in score of global acne grading system (51.0 vs. 38.5%) and acne lesion counts (non-inflammatory lesion: 63.2 vs. 44.5%; inflammatory lesions: 75.9 vs. 62.7%; total lesions: 66.07 vs. 48.7%; all p< 0.05). Flaring up of acne occurred less frequently and adverse effects were more tolerable in levocetirizine group. Conclusion Use of antihistamine with isotretinoin provides synergic effect while minimizing the side effect of isotretinoin and greater clearance of the lesion and scars.

Trifolium alexandrinum (Egyptian clover) is a widely cultivated winter annual fodder. Present work deals with inheritance of the seed coat colour in segregating progenies of the interspecific cross between T. alexandrinum and T. apertum. Although, both the parent species possessed yellow seed coat, the F1 seeds were black coloured in the reciprocal cross (T. apertum × T. alexandrinum). Seeds borne on individual F2 plants and the advancing generations segregated in yellow and black seed coat colour, which confirmed xenia effect. F2 seeds collected from individual F1 plants exhibited nine black and seven yellow segregation ratio. The segregation of the seed coat colour recorded from F3 to F5 generations revealed that yellow seed coat was true breeding (i.e. non-segregating) in this interspecific cross (including the reciprocal crosses). However, the black seeded progenies were either true breeding or segregated in nine black: seven yellow ratio or three black: one yellow ratio suggesting a complementary gene interaction or duplicate recessive epistasis. It indicated that the seed coat colour is controlled by complementary gene interaction along with xenia effect in interspecific crosses between T. alexandrinum and T. apertum. Occurrence of the complementary genes across the species could suggest T. apertum to be the progenitor of T. alexandrinum. Inheritance of seed coat colour in reference to its importance in Egyptian clover breeding is also discussed.

Acute diarrhoea is one of the leading causes of mortality in infants and young children. Evidence suggests that probiotics can reduce diarrhoea duration. As the effects of probiotics are strain specific, the effect of Bacillus clausii UBBC-07, a safe probiotic strain in the treatment of acute diarrhoea in children was studied. The double blind, randomised, placebo-controlled, parallel group multicentric study was conducted at two outpatient facility sites in Lucknow, India. Children aged six months to five years suffering from acute diarrhoea, were randomly assigned to receive either probiotic (B. clausii UBBC-07) spore suspension or placebo suspension twice daily apart from oral rehydration solution (ORS). The duration of treatment was for five days with a follow -up until the 10th day. Outcomes evaluated were duration and frequency of diarrhoea, consistency of stool, fever and vomiting. The duration of diarrhoea was significantly shorter (P<0.05) in patients who received B. clausii suspension (75.66±13.23 h) than in placebo treated group (81.6±15.43 h). The average daily number of stools (frequency) was 8.67±3.42 at baseline in treatment group receiving B. clausii and 8.53±3.19 in placebo group. By day 4, there was a significant reduction (P<0.01) in frequency of stools in probiotic treated group (3.46±0.66) as compared to placebo group (4.57±1.59). Improvement in stool consistency was also observed in the probiotic treated group as compared to the placebo group. There was no effect on vomiting and duration of fever. B. clausii UBBC-07 significantly decreased the duration and frequency of diarrhoea as compared to placebo indicating effectiveness of strain in the treatment of acute diarrhoea in children and could be a safe alternative to antibiotics.

Acute primary tuberculous ulcer of glans penis is a rare entity even in the endemic region. We present a 55 year old male with multiple undermined ulcers for short duration of 4 weeks with raised erythrocyte sedimentation rate, negative Mantoux test and histopathology revealed a diagnosis of tuberculous ulcer which responded well to antitubercular therapy.

We observe a sixfold Purcell broadening of the D_{2} line of an optically trapped ^{87}Rb atom strongly coupled to a fiber cavity. Under external illumination by a near-resonant laser, up to 90% of the atom's fluorescence is emitted into the resonant cavity mode. The sub-Poissonian statistics of the cavity output and the Purcell enhancement of the atomic decay rate are confirmed by the observation of a strongly narrowed antibunching dip in the photon autocorrelation function. The photon leakage through the higher-transmission mirror of the single-sided resonator is the dominant contribution to the field decay (κ≈2π×50 MHz), thus offering a high-bandwidth, fiber-coupled channel for photonic interfaces such as quantum memories and single-photon sources.
